What Makes This Different
The ARO-EVO SPR features Holosun's Multi-Reticle System with both 2 MOA dot and 65 MOA circle options. Solar failsafe technology automatically switches between battery and solar power based on lighting conditions. The included HM3X magnifier flips to either side for ambidextrous operation and provides 3x magnification without affecting the red dot's zero.
Key Features
- Multi-Reticle System with 2 MOA dot and 65 MOA circle reticle options
- Solar Failsafe technology with CR2032 battery backup
- HM3X 3x magnifier with flip-to-side QD mount
- Shake Awake motion activation conserves battery life
- 12 brightness settings including 2 NV compatible
- Picatinny rail mount fits standard 1913 rails
- IPX8 waterproof rating for all-weather reliability

Technical Specs
- Reticle: 2 MOA dot with 65 MOA circle
- Magnification: 1x red dot, 3x with HM3X engaged
- Eye Relief: Unlimited (red dot), 2.5 inches (magnifier)
- Battery Life: 50,000 hours on setting 6
- Operating Temperature: -20°F to +140°F
- Mount: Lower 1/3 co-witness height
- Weight: Approximately 8.5 oz (complete system)
- Warranty: 3-year manufacturer warranty
